Handover note — supplier contract renewal. From K. Arnesson to incoming director M. Tovey, for board review. The Fennick Materials agreement expires in March. Pricing renegotiated at a 4% reduction with a two-year term and revised delivery penalties. Legal has cleared the draft; signature pending board approval. The confidential note below summarises the commercial plans behind this renewal.

confidential, kagep-kahof: Druokax Systems plans to lower the Ulaath list price by 53 percent in March.

Ticket: Wren relay websocket clients failing to reconnect after idle. Root cause: the relay's internal credential expired Tuesday, so reauth on reconnect is rejected with a generic close code. Fix deployed; clients must be restarted with the rotated credential. The new key for the relay service follows directly below.

API key for yahig-tadup: kto7_ubizbYm

**Management Meeting Minutes — FY Headcount Plan**

Present: Voss, Ilmari, Okonde. Agreed: net growth capped at forty roles. Fieldstone unit gains twelve; Perch platform team gains eight. Backfill freeze continues in support until Q2. Contractor conversions reviewed case by case. Department submissions due in two weeks. Rationale for the cap is stated below.

internal memo for fahif-bawip: Headcount on the Ralael team goes from 48 to 96 by the end of December. Gross margin on Ralael came in at 14 percent against a plan of 3 percent.

## Service Accounts — StormFan Alert Fan-Out

The fan-out worker authenticates to the internal dispatch tier using the svc-stormfan account. Rotate quarterly; scopes are limited to publish-only on alert topics. If deliveries stall during your shift, verify the worker is using the current credential, reproduced below for reference.

API key for kaweg-hahif: kto4_rAjZ

The Feedlark podcast feed validator stopped authenticating against the internal Cravenport schema registry on Tuesday; its service credential expired after the standard 90-day window. Validation jobs have been queued, not dropped, so no data loss occurred. Per rotation policy, the replacement credential was minted with identical, read-only scopes. The new registry key is provided below.

service key, tadup-tahog: zpat7_wB1tnEL